How Far From Redland to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ers, Almanacs & Directories that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as Redland to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in Redland and extending to:

  • Prescott, which is the Seat of Nevada County, lies just to the West.
  • Little Rock, which is the State Capital of Arkansas, lies 86 miles [138.4 km]<1> to the northeast (NE). If you could drive a straight line from Redland to Little Rock, with an average speed<5>of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, it would take less than two hours to make the trip. A comfortable walk of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our would take 5 days.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take most of three days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 967 miles [1,556.2 km] to the east northeast (ENE). Driving would take most of two days, a buggy would take 38 days and walking would take 55 days.

<6>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Redland to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.
